An aortic valve usually has three leaflets and is called a tricuspid aortic valve; but sometimes an aortic valve has two leaflets, which is then called a bicuspid aortic valve. Some people can be born with one, two or even four cusps of their aortic valve. In addition to early valve degeneration, people with bicuspid aortic valves carry a risk for enlargement, or aneurysm development, of the ascending aorta, which is the main blood vessel that carries blood out of the heart. Although bicuspid aortic valves can occur sporadically without any inheritance pattern, the condition also can run in families. The actual cause of bicuspid aortic valve disease is not completely clear. Yang says the danger of the aneurysm is dissection and rupture, which could be fatal. Family history. When people are born with a bicuspid aortic valve, the bicuspid valve typically functions well throughout childhood and early adulthood. DEAR MAYO CLINIC: I consider myself to be in good health. Bicuspid aortic valve (BAV) is an inherited form of heart disease in which two of the leaflets of the aortic valve fuse during development in the womb resulting in a two-leaflet valve (bicuspid valve) instead of the normal three-leaflet valve (tricuspid). At that point, people with bicuspid aortic valves may notice shortness of breath, difficulty exercising, lightheadedness or chest pain. In this study, the investigators will examine the effect of high dose of Menaquinone-7 (MK-7) supplementation (1000 mcg)/day on the progression of the aortic valve disease. Studies suggest that up to 75% of people with bicuspid aortic valves will require intervention at some point in their lives. Health care providers usually diagnose bicuspid aortic valves with an ultrasound of the heart called an echocardiogram.
